Step 1: Emergency Response
Our crew will arrive at your property within 60 minutes, equipped with the necessary gear to tackle the sewage backup. We’ll begin by containing the affected area to prevent further damage and risk of contamination.
Step 2: Water Removal
Using our specialized equipment, we’ll extract the standing water from your property, including any affected areas, such as crawl spaces, basements, or garages.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and growth of bacteria and other microorganisms.
Step 3: Disinfection and Sanitizing
We’ll use a combination of industrial-strength disinfectants and sanitizers to kill any bacteria, viruses, or other microorganisms that may be present in the affected area. This step is critical in preventing the spread of disease and ensuring your property is safe for occupancy.
Step 4: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the area has been fully disinfected and sanitized, our crew will use specialized equipment to dry out the affected area, including any walls, floors, and ceilings. We’ll also set up dehumidifiers to remove any remaining moisture and prevent further damage.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Our crew will conduct a thorough inspection of the affected area to ensure that all damage has been repaired and the area is safe for occupancy. We’ll also conduct a final cleaning of the area to remove any remaining debris and odors.

Q: Can I use bleach to clean up a sewage backup?
A: No, we strongly advise against using bleach or any other household cleaning products to clean up a sewage backup. Bleach can actually make the situation worse by spreading the contamination and causing further damage. Our team uses industrial-strength disinfectants and sanitizers specifically designed for sewage cleanup and disinfection.
